FY25 Financial Performance Highlights

  • πŸ“ˆ Accenture reported 7% revenue growth in fiscal year 2025, adding $5 billion in revenue, with $80 billion in bookings against a challenging macroeconomic backdrop.
  • πŸ’° The company delivered strong earnings per share growth and generated robust free cash flow, both exceeding guidance on an adjusted basis.
  • 🎯 Accenture took market share at more than 5x its investable basket, reflecting the relevance of its services and diversified portfolio.
  • πŸ“Š Full fiscal year 2025 revenues reached $69.7 billion, with an adjusted operating margin of 15.6% and adjusted EPS of $12.93.

Advanced AI Leadership and Investment

  • πŸš€ A $3 billion multi-year investment in GenAI is paying off, with FY25 revenue from Advanced AI (GenAI, Agentic AI, Physical AI) tripling to $2.7 billion.
  • πŸ’‘ Advanced AI bookings nearly doubled to $5.9 billion, demonstrating significant client adoption and demand for these cutting-edge technologies.
  • 🧠 Accenture has expanded its AI and data professional workforce to 77,000 and trained over 550,000 employees in GenAI fundamentals, working on more than 6,000 Advanced AI projects this year.
  • βœ… The company views AI as expansionary, not deflationary, with efficiency gains reinvested into new client priorities and growth opportunities.

Strategic Client Engagement and Ecosystem

  • 🀝 Accenture continues to be the number one partner for the tech ecosystem, with 60% of its revenue derived from work with its top 10 ecosystem partners.
  • πŸ”‘ The company added 129 clients with quarterly bookings greater than $100 million for the year, finishing with 305 diamond clients (largest relationships).
  • 🌐 Client transformations are deepening, with examples including a major financial services client whose contract value more than doubled over five years due to AI integration, and the Bank of England's RTGS system modernization.
  • πŸ› οΈ Strategic acquisitions like Cyber CX (APAC cybersecurity) and IM Concepts (Canadian identity security) are strengthening Accenture's capabilities and geographic reach, particularly in AI-powered security platforms.

Workforce and Business Reinvention

  • 🌱 Accenture is actively reinventing its workforce through a three-pronged talent strategy focusing on upskilling, exiting non-viable reskilling paths, and driving efficiencies.
  • βš™οΈ A business optimization program was initiated, incurring an $865 million charge for talent rotation and divestiture of non-strategic acquisitions, with expected savings of over $1 billion to be reinvested.
  • πŸ”„ The launch of Reinvention Services aims to unify Accenture's capabilities, making it faster and simpler to sell and deliver offerings, and to embed more AI and data.

FY26 Outlook and Growth Strategy

  • πŸ“ˆ For fiscal year 2026, Accenture projects revenue growth of 2-5% in local currency (3-6% excluding federal business), with an estimated $3 billion investment in acquisitions.
  • πŸ’° The company expects adjusted operating margin to expand to 15.7-15.9% and adjusted diluted EPS to grow 5-8% to a range of $13.52-$13.90.
  • πŸ’Έ Accenture plans to return at least $9.3 billion to shareholders, an increase of 12% from FY25, and approved $5 billion in additional share repurchase authority.
  • πŸ‘₯ Headcount is expected to grow across all markets in FY26, reflecting continued demand and strategic hiring.
